The sound is brought on by debris accumulating in the bottom of the heater. As a result of the warm water gurgling up, with the debris, in the bottom of the tank. When this takes place, it creates a standing out audio. 2 ways to avoid it: 1) Flush your water heater out periodically. Vacant it, open the cold water consumption and also fill the water tank halfway while enabling the stream of the water to rinse the debris from inside the tank. Vacant the water with the drainpipe valve and also repeat the process up until you do not see any kind of signs of debris left in the tank. 2) Set up a water conditioner in your house. The water conditioner will certainly remove the debris that accumulates in your tank.
If ELECTRIC, first, reset any kind of tripped circuit breaker and also change any kind of blown fuse. Next off, press the water heater reset switch(s). Someplace on your electric water heater, you’ll discover a reset switch. It’s normally red and also usually located near the thermostat. It might additionally be hidden behind a removable steel panel on the device– and after that behind some insulation. As soon as you discover the switch, press and also release it. While you have the accessibility panel off, see if there’s a second thermostat and also 2nd reset switch. If the switch trips once more instantly after you press it, something’s not working properly, and also you ought to call for among our ninja-plumbers.

Water Heater Quit Working
When there’s no warm water, the trouble can stem from lack of power, a faulty electric thermostat or a faulty upper electric burner. Begin by ruling out power issues. First, reset any kind of tripped circuit breaker, and also change any kind of blown fuse. Next off, examine if power is being provided to the electric water burner thermostat. Evaluate the element, and also if it’s defective, change it. Finally, if the thermostat is obtaining power yet is still not working, change it or the electric water burner. Shut off the water! If you experience a leaking water heater, it is recommended to turn off the water to your tank. Your water heater tank ought to have a dedicated shutoff valve on the chilly inlet pipes. If this is a gate-style valve (a wheel that turns), transform the valve clockwise as for you can. If the valve is a ball-style valve, transform the handle 180 degrees. Call us for assistance at 877-814-9725 If the valve is damaged, you can shut the water off to your residence. Each residence must have a major water shut off valve that would certainly quit the flow of water to the whole home. Water Heater Lacks Hot Water Rapidly: Possible Reasons That. As mentioned over, numerous points can trigger a residence's warm water supply to run out faster than it should. The three most typical culprits are debris develop, a faulty burner and also a busted dip tube.
Hot water would last just a couple of mins and after that just cold water would certainly be appearing. So the trouble, specifically with older water heaters is pretty typical. So, if your water heater is "of a specific age" chances are you've obtained a busted or disintegrated dip tube and also you need to change it.

Water heaters ought to not be positioned directly on the "dust," yet they can (absolutely) be installed at floor level with no risk of "exploding." The Uniform Plumbing Code, which establishes requirements nationwide, states that the flame or stimulating mechanism in a gas water heater should go to the very least 18 inches off the ground.
There are a number of factors that your water heater can blow up; however, the primary reason behind water heater explosions is pressure. Anything that creates excess pressure on your water heating unit, such as an inadequate anode rod, or a lot of debris build-up, can all trigger your water heater to take off.
